Our History

                                                                                

      A&H Wayside Furniture was founded in 1971, in Reidsville, NC to serve the local

furniture consumer, and to provide the out of state buyer with furniture savings

that couldn't be achieved by consumers outside of North Carolina.  It was started

by Curtis Apple & Tim Hinkle.  Mr. Hinkle purchased the remainder of the company

from Mr. Apple in the late '80s and began an expansion project placing stores in High

Point, NC.  The entire Hinkle family still runs the business today. 

     Today A&H Wayside services clients throughout the fifty US states, Canada, Mexico

and abroad.  With the qualified design staff and easy access to over 300 manufacturing

brands, the company can satisfy every furniture and home accessory need.  A&H offers

everything from low-end to the high-end furniture in terms of price and quality, and has 

completed many individual client projects abroad, including Mexico, the Middle-East, Europe,

Australia and the Carribean.  "There isn't a furniture project we cannot handle", says 

Tim Hinkle, President of A&H.  "We take pride in working with every customer that walks into

our store, or contacts us through the phone or internet.  We can provide that individual looking

for just a mattress, lamp or a mirror, then turn around and sell 200 bedrooms, entertainment

consoles and a truckload of accessories to a chain of Hotels." 

     A&H has two full-service retail stores in High Point and Reidsville, and a clearance center

on Tate St. in High Point, that focuses solely on market samples, closeouts, and other clearance

furniture usually purchased from many different manufacturers at deep wholesale discounts.  

According to Tim Hinkle, "If we can't find what it is you're looking for, then it probably doesn't

exist, and if it doesn't exist then we know somebody who can make it."
